Your Brain Builds Highways When You Engage | Texas News
New brain research reveals that active engagement—like wrestling with new information—triggers real rewiring in the brain, building fresh neural pathways for lasting learning. Advanced imaging shows key brain regions light up more during focused effort than passive absorption, proving deep involvement is crucial for retention. This isn’t just theory—it’s biology confirming what educators and self-learners already know: doing matters more than reading.
